ENGLAND’s Lionesses have celebrated their Euro 2025 triumph in style with thousands of fans in central London.
The parade began with Sarina Wiegman and her squad travelling along The Mall in an open-top bus before concluding with a staged ceremony at the Queen Victoria Memorial in front of Buckingham Palace.
England captain Leah Williamson fought back tears on stage as she told fans during her speech that she’d been crying the whole way down The Mall.
On Sunday, Chloe Kelly and Hannah Hampton wrote themselves into English footballing history with their heroics during the penalty shootout victory over Spain.
The Lionesses successfully defended their status as European champions and became the first English senior team to win a major tournament on foreign soil.
